Nursing implications:

Obtain a sample for lab culture before initiating therapy.

1 Monitor for evidence of superinfection.

2 Tell patients to complete the course of treatment to prevent resistance strands from developing.

3 Monitor for N/V/D and anaphylaxis or allergic reaction.

Chapter 26: Penicillins, and Cephalosporins

Drug class Drugs Action and use

Adverse effects Nursing implications

Penicillin  

Amoxicillin, nafcillin, piperacillin

Bactericidal: Destroy bacteria cell wall  

Anorexia, nausea, vomiting, and diarrhea abdominal pain, dysphagia, rash, Hypersensitivity, anaphylaxis Superinfection Tongue discoloration, stomatitis

-Assess for allergy to penicillin or cephalosporins Have epinephrine available to counteract a severe allergic reaction.

Cephalosporin s Broad spectrum   TABLE 26.5

Cefazolin, cefuroxime Ceftriaxone Cefepime, ceftaroline

Bactericidal: Destroy bacteria cell wall

anorexia, nausea, vomiting, headache, dizziness, itching, and rash, nephrotoxicity. Increased bleeding, seizures Nephrotoxicity  

-May cause a disulfiram-like reaction if taken with alcohol. Flushing, dizziness, Headache, nausea, vomiting, and muscular cramps -Assess for allergy to cephalosporins or penicillin - Advise patient to take medication with food if gastric irritation occurs.

Chapter 27: Macrolides, Oxazolidinones, Lincosamides, Glycopeptides

Macrolides Erythromycin Azithromycin Clarithromycin fidaxomicin

Bacteriostatic: Prevent protein synthesis within bacterial cells Strep infections, STDs

nausea, vomiting, diarrhea, and abdominal cramping, hepatotoxicity

Monitor vital signs, liver function,

Oxazolidinones  

linezolid (Zyvox) Treat MRSA, and VRE Inhibits protein synthesis

headache, nausea, vomiting, diarrhea, anemia, and thrombocytopenia, serotonin syndrome.

 

Lincosamides Clindamycin   hairy skin, nausea, vomiting, diarrhea, CDAD, erythema, pruritus, superinfection, headache, candidiasis, and back pain.

 

Glycopeptides vancomycin (Vancocin)

Inhibits cell wall synthesis

Anaphylaxis, superinfection Red neck or red man syndrome Occurs when IV too rapid Severe hypotension Red blotching of face, neck, chest, and extremities Disulfiram-like reaction to alcohol Ototoxicity and nephrotoxicity

-Monitor peak and trough -Administer slowly over 1 hour -Monitor kidney function -Administer antihistamine to treat redman syndrome Therapeutic range: Trough: 5–20 mcg/mL Peak: 30–40 mcg/mL

Chapter 28: Tetracyclines, Aminoglycosides, and Fluoroquinolones

Tetracycline Wide spectrum

Doxycycline, demeclocycline

Bacteriostatic: Inhibit protein synthesis

Anaphylaxis, superinfection Photosensitivity, diplopia Discoloration of permanent teeth Do not give to children younger than 8 years Ototoxicity, hepatotoxicity, nephrotoxicity  

-Monitor liver and kidney function. -Do not take while pregnant -Not given to children below 8 years

Aminoglycosid es Mostly gram -ve

gentamicin neomycin (Neo- fradin) tobramycin (TOBI) amikacin

Bactericidal; prevents protein synthesis

Anaphylaxis, superinfection, seizures Photosensitivity, anemia, stomatitis, GI distress Ototoxicity, nephrotoxicity, neurotoxicity Clostridium difficile–associated diarrhea Stevens-Johnson syndrome

-Assess intake and output -Assess renal function -Note peak and trough levels -increase fluid intake Peak: 5–8 mcg/mL Trough: <1–2 mcg/mL

Fluoroquinolon es Broad spectrum

ciprofloxacin (Cipro) norfloxacin (Noroxin) levofloxacin (Levaquin)

Bactericidal: Alter DNA of bacteria, causing death

Photosensitivity, eye damage, visual disturbances GI distress, dysgeusia Tendinitis, tendon rupture  

Use sunscreen. Monitor kidney function. Monitor blood glucose. Levofloxacin can increase the effects of oral hypoglycemics

Chapter 29: Sulfonamides and Nitroimidazoles Antibiotics

Drug class Drugs Action and use Adverse effects Nursing implications

Sulfonamides Broad spectrum

Sulfamethoxazole Sulfamethoxazole and trimethoprim(SMX- TMP,)

Bacteriostatic: Prevent synthesis of folic acid, TX of UTIs, PJP

Anaphylaxis Photosensitivity GI distress, stomatitis Insomnia, tinnitus Crystalluria, renal failure Blood dyscrasias Stevens-Johnson syndrome

-Avoid exposure to the sun or -wear sunscreen -Monitor CBC -Give with a full glass of water  

Nitroimidazoles metronidazole (Flagyl) Intraabdominal and gynecologic infections Interferes with DNA

Headache, dizziness, insomnia, weakness Dry mouth, dysgeusia, GI distress Tongue/tooth discoloration Peripheral neuropathy, seizures Disulfiram-like reaction

Avoid alcohol

Miscellaneous Antibiotics    

nitrofurantoin (Macrodantin)        

Primarily used for UTIs Disrupt bacteria cell wall formation

Hepatotoxicity, blood dyscrasias, dizziness, Headache, skin rash

 

Chapter 30: Antitubercular

Drug class Drug action Adverse effect Nursing implications

Antitubercular Isoniazid (INH) Inhibits bacterial cell wall synthesis

Dry mouth, GI distress, constipation Blurred vision, photosensitivity, tinnitus Drowsiness, dizziness, peripheral neuropathy Psychotic behavior, tremors, seizures Hyperglycemia, hepatotoxicity Thrombocytopenia, agranulocytosis

Give pyridoxine (vitamin B6) to prevent peripheral neuropathy. Monitor hepatic function tests. Emphasize importance of complying with drug regimen.

Antitubercular Rifampin   turns body fluids orange. Soft contact lens may be permanently discolored

 

Antitubercular ethambutol   Visual problems including blindness

 

Antitubercular Pyrazinamide   arthralgia and myalgia. May also cause hepatotoxicity and thrombocytopenia. Monitor LFTs and serum uric acid.

 

Chapter 30 :Antifungals

Antifungal Griseofulvin Disrupts cell division

Numbness, tingling, stomach ache, N,V,D, heart burn

 

Antifungal amphotericin B Bind to sterols in cell membrane lining, causing cell death

Neurotoxicity Renal toxicity Pulmonary infiltrates fever, shaking, chills, flushing, loss of appetite, dizziness, nausea, vomiting, headache, shortness of breath, and tachypnea.

Premedicate Antipyretic Antihistamines Corticosteroids NsAIDs Reliable IV access    

Antifungal nystatin Similar to Amphotericin B

Skin irritation, rash, pruritus GI distress Hyperglycemia, tachycardia Angioedema, bronchospasm Stevens-Johnson syndrome

 

Antifungal fluconazole Destroy cell wall Nausea, vomiting, diarrhea, stomach pain, Increased liver enzymes

31: Antimalarials and Anthelmintics

Antimalarial Chloroquine phosphate

Inhibit the growth of the parasite

anorexia, nausea, vomiting, diarrhea abdominal cramps headache, pruritus’, nervousness, visual impairment, insomnia, photosensitivity, hair discoloration. Seizures, confusion, psychosis , ototoxicity Renal impairment, hepatomegaly Hemolytic anemia Cardiovascular effects

Monitor renal and liver function by checking urine output and liver enzymes. Monitor the patient for impaired consciousness, Headache, or seizures. Monitor patients returning from malaria- endemic areas for malarial symptoms.

Antimalarial hydroxychloroqui ne

Same as above Same as above Same as above

Anthelmintic s

Ivermectin Destroy parasitic worms

Dizziness, Headache, pruritus, Lymph node swelling, Ocular opacity, tachycardia, Elevated hepatic enzymes

Assess the patient for complaints of anal itching and abdominal discomfort. Monitor the patient for adverse effects. Explain to the patient the importance of handwashing before meals and after use of the toilet
